The journey started for Rohit in Nagpur on 30th April 1987 to Gurunath & Purnima Sharma. From a very young age, Rohit developed an interest in playing cricket. Rohit made his List A debut for West Zone in the Deodhar Trophy. Rohit made his India debut in 2007, playing against Ireland at Belfast.
He then went on to represent in the inaugural T20 World Cup in 2007, his underated knock of an unbeaten 30 in the finals proved a key figure in helping India win the title, beating arch-rivals Pakistan in the finals.

Rohit Sharma's 264 against Sri Lanka in 2014 in Eden Gardens, Kolkata, is still the highest ever score recorded in the history of ODI Cricket. Rohit went berserk after his catch was dropped by Thisara Perera at third man.
Rohit found his sublime touch & unleashed 33 boundaries while sending the white SG ball 9 times over the ropes to record the highest score of 264 off 173 balls.
Rohit Sharma holds the record for smashing the most hundreds (5) in a single edition of the ODI World Cup in 2019 in England & Wales. This is the most smashed by a player in the ODI World Cups. Rohit scored 648 runs in 9 innings, surpassing Kumar Sangakkara's record of centuries (4) in the 2015 World Cup edition in Australia & New Zealand.
Rohit's five hundreds came against South Africa (122), Pakistan (140), Sri Lanka (103), Bangladesh (104) & England (102).
Even though Rohit has the highest ODI score of 264, the star batter from Mumbai has achieved this feat thrice in ODI Cricket. 209 vs Australia, Bengaluru, 2013, 264 vs Sri Lanka, 2014, Kolkata & 208* vs Sri Lanka in 2017, Mohali. Hence, Rohit Sharma is the only batter to record 3 Double tons in ODI Cricket.
A young Rohit Sharma scored his first ton in the IPL against the Kolkata Knight Riders at his favorite venue in the Eden Gardens. In the presence of stalwarts Sachin Tendulkar & Ricky Ponting, this young boy from Nagpur smashed a breathtaking 109 off 60 that helped the Mumbai Indians to win that match by 27 runs.
Rohit finally broke his 12-year wait of smashing an IPL ton against Arch-Rivals Chennai Super Kings last year, smashing a brilliant unbeaten 105*, albeit in a losing cause at the Wankhede Stadium in Mumbai. Rohit laced 11 boundaries and 5 sixes in that match.
In the fourteenth match of IPL 2018, Rohit Sharma blasted a blazing 94 after Umesh Yadav got Suryakumar Yadav & Ishan Kishan early. Rohit on Turbo mode made a magnificent 94 off 52 balls to help MI beat Virat Kohli-led RCB.
